Televisions for Small Spaces


If you need a television for a space that's restricted in size -- a dorm room or the kitchen in a small apartment, for example -- you are in luck. There is a whole host of high-quality digital receivers available that will keep out of your way, but still allow you to catch up on what's going on in the world.


coby 10Like this Coby 10" Under-Cabinet Combination TV ($154). Hang this little TV under a kitchen cabinet or dorm room book shelf and you have digital reception while saving valuable space. You get a 10" screen, digital tuner, plus a DVD/CD player and an AM/FM radio. The operating parameters are displayed on the screen and the stereo speakers -- while small at just 3" -- provide nice separation. If the TV doesn't keep you sufficiently occupied, use the video and audio input jacks for games or tunes.
samsung 19
If you have a conveniently located tabletop, check out this Samsung 19" LED Television ($238); the screen has an integrated digital tuner and HDMI input for games, 720p resolution for a crisp viewing experience, proprietary SRS speakers that offer up full-bodied sound, and a port for a USB device so you can access your media files, controlling all with the included remote. This TV would be ideal for a kid's room.
phillips 22
Moving up to a (relatively) larger size, for a small space, this Phillips 22" LCD Television ($179). Progressive scanning HD resolution, Surround Sound for the audio end of things, and PC and HDMI inputs for your computer, DVD and Blu-ray players, and various game consoles. The TV is Energy Star-rated and features a tilt stand for optimal viewing, a remote (with included batteries) and a one year (limited) warranty.
